This challenge was based on patterned papers. No cardstock for background!! I chose to challenge myself a bit more and chose a really fun paper patterned with lovely flowers. To make the photo show better I chose to whitewash the background a bit with gesso and took a black-and-white photo so it wouldn't just blend in with the background.
